Product Description

World-class clubs for world-class golfers. A forged, notch back bade iron design for elite golfers seeking the ultimate in shot-making and distance control.

  • Forged 1020 carbon steel construction for unmatched performance
  • Thinnest top line of any Callaway iron
  • Notch back design increases stability through impact and enhances feel
  • Provides ideal trajectories and precision distance control
  • Project X Shaft

I am a average golfer looking for new clubs...current set had extra inch added to shaft length, but not sure I needed it. I am 6'2"...would a custom club fitting be recommended or would std shaf
A
05/21/2009 8:44 AMGolfballs.com Employee: Andy
Thank you for your inquiry. Typically guys your height will need added length to the shaft with an upright lie angle. Your arm length from wrist to floor will give a better idea as to how much additional length is needed. The majority of golfers in your height range would benefit from a 1/2" extended shaft and a 2 degree upright lie angle.
